Fog is measured where instruments live — airports. Hours/yr = time below CAT I approach minima (visibility under ~½ mile or ceiling under 200 ft), the aviation definition of seriously dense fog.

When Amarillo fogs in

Fog here concentrates in January and December — about 44 hours in a typical year at KAMA, usually lasting ~2 h once it forms. Hour-by-hour patterns, live conditions and the forecast strip live on the KAMA station page.
